WARNING There are potentially hazardous voltages (210 V) present at the High Force, High
Sense, and Guard terminals of Agilent B2900A. To prevent electrical shock, the
following safety precautions must be observed during the use of the B2900A.
• Use a three-conductor AC power code to connect the cabinet (if used) and the
B2900A to an electrical ground (safety ground).
• If you do not use the Agilent 16442B Test fixture, you must install and connect
an interlock circuit that opens the interlock terminal when the shielding box
access door is opened.
• Confirm periodically that the interlock function works normally.
• Before touching the connections on the High Force, High Sense, and Guard
terminals, turn the B2900 off and discharge any capacitors. If you do not turn
the B2900 off, complete all of the following items, regardless of the B2900

•Press the
On/Off key, and confirm that the key turns off.
• Confirm that the
On/Off key does not turn red.
• Open the shielding box access door (open the interlock terminal).
• Discharge any capacitors connected to a channel.
• Warn persons working around the B2900A about dangerous conditions.
